    Dakota (we call him 'kota or Duke) is now 20 lbs/9kg and is 5.5 yrs old. He seems to be maturing more this year and filling out more. He dad, Zunicoon Hulk, is over 25 lbs/11.4kg. 'Kota was the most adorable kitten (aren't they all?!?!). He was all legs and ears, but he had the most pathetic tail for several years!

    These pics are when he was 12 wks old and 9 mo old. I know you will enjoy your babies as much as we do ours. They don't really get older, just bigger!

    Maine Coons were almost non existent for sale (at least to my knowledge) here in Singapore (not even in petshops, no breeders; registered or back yard breeders) back in the late 80s and early 90s.

    When I discovered my Rocco (brown tabby) from a registered MC breeder who owns a petshop (this breeder only owns 1 stud MC), I bought him without hesitation due to the limited availability of MC in Singapore. Until to date, there are only 2 registered MC breeders in Singapore....so, the choice of colors are very limited.

    When I bought Merlin and Dyman from Poland, it was mainly because the breeder is willing to send them to Singapore, so I did not have a whole long list of breeders to choose from. It was either the breeders are not willing to send their kittens from Europe to Asia OR they are willing, only if 2 kittens are purchased at once for the price of EURO 5000 (this was 2 years ago EURO exchange rate was at it's highest peak, excluding airfreight and quarantine charges). If none of the above was an issue, my dream color would definitely be a Blue Smoke (preferably with Mackeral masking), a Solid Blue and finally a Black Smoke.

    I did come across a Solid Blue male kitten at a petshop (claims to be imported from Perth, Australia but without papers/pedigree) in August 2010 for the price of SGD $3200 (around EURO 1950).
    Buying a pet MC kitten (neutered) from a local registered breeder is between SGD $2000 - $2500.

    You guys in Europe and USA are so very lucky when it comes to choices of breeders and colors.
